General Function

Responsible for assisting Private Bank Account Officers and working with clients to obtain required information and documentation needed to facilitate the account termination process.  The primary function of the Private Bank Account Closing Specialist will be to gather required documentation and communicate with clients and outside firms related to the termination of Investment Management, Trust and Individual Retirement accounts.   This role will be the subject matter expert regarding account termination requirements, the information and documentation required to close each type of account, the process to obtain any necessary approvals related to an account closing and the process to submit closing requests to the appropriate Fulfillment Center team for processing. 

Essential Duties and Responsibilities  

  • Responsible for preparing and obtaining all necessary documentation to facilitate the closing of investment management, trust, and individual retirement accounts.
  • Ensure documentation is complete, accurate and stored as required by policy and procedure.
  • Providing regular and frequent communication with clients and/or external advisors to ensure seamless offboarding experience.
  • Serve as the subject matter expert relative to all information and documentation required for each type of account termination as well as the process to facilitate the closing workflow.
  • Submit Account Closing requests on behalf of Private Bank Account Officers for processing.
  • Provide status updates on account closing and asset transfers process to Private Bank Officers as needed throughout the life of the closing process.

What you need to know about the Chicago Tech Scene

With vibrant neighborhoods, great food and more affordable housing than either coast, Chicago might be the most liveable major tech hub. It is the birthplace of modern commodities and futures trading, a national hub for logistics and commerce, and home to the American Medical Association and the American Bar Association. This diverse blend of industry influences has helped Chicago emerge as a major player in verticals like fintech, biotechnology, legal tech, e-commerce and logistics technology. It’s also a major hiring center for tech companies on both coasts.

Key Facts About Chicago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 245,800; 5.2%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: McDonald’s, John Deere, Boeing, Morningstar
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, fintech, software, logistics technology
  • Funding Landscape: $2.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Pritzker Group Venture Capital, Arch Venture Partners, MATH Venture Partners, Jump Capital, Hyde Park Venture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: Northwestern University, University of Chicago, University of Illinois Urbana-Champaign, Illinois Institute of Technology, Argonne National Laboratory, Fermi National Accelerator Laboratory
